Beef Choufleur
 Beef Choufleur
 
 
This dish is a fusion of east and west; it combines butter-browned beef with a savory sauce of soy sauce, garlic and broth.
 
6 oz    beef round steak, 1/3-inch thick  
2 tsp    butter or margarine  
1 1/4 cups    cauliflower florets  
1/2   small green bell pepper, seeded and cut into ¾-inch pieces  
4 tsp    soy sauce  
1/2   clove garlic, minced  
2 tsp    cornstarch  
1/8 tsp    sugar  
1/2 cup    beef broth or water  
1/3 cup    sliced green onions  
1 cup    hot cooked rice  
 
1 Cut meat into ½-inch squares. Brown meat in butter about 5 minutes. Add cauliflower, green pepper, soy sauce and garlic. Stir lightly to coat vegetables with soy sauce. Cover pan and simmer until vegetables are barely tender, about 10 minutes.
2 Blend cornstarch, sugar and broth. Add to meat mixture with green onions. Cook, stirring constantly, until thoroughly heated and sauce is thickened. Serve over beds of fluffy rice.
 
Servings: 2
Preparation time: 10 minutes
Cooking time: 20 minutes
